909338 The Death of King James the First, 1625 (etching) by Hollar, Wenceslaus (1607-77) (after); Private Collection; (add.info.: James I, King of England, James VI of Scotland (1566-1625) on his death-bed, attended by his favourite the Duke of Buckingham whose personal physician Dr Lamb is handing the king a remedy, in a broadside referring to rumours of his poisoning. ); Bohemian, out of copyright.
